Plan Features/Benefits
  • Profit-sharing
  • Total participant-directed account plan - Participants have the opportunity to direct the investment of all the assets allocated to their individual accounts, regardless of whether 29 CFR 2550.404c-1 is intended to be met.
  • Code section 401(k) feature - A cash or deferred arrangement described in Code section 401(k) that is part of a qualified defined contribution plan that provides for an election by employees to defer part of their compensation or receive these amounts in cash.
  • Participant-directed brokerage accounts provided as an investment option under the plan.
  • Plan provides for automatic enrollment in plan that has employee contributions deducted from payroll.
  • Total or partial participant-directed account plan - plan uses default investment account for participants who fail to direct assets in their account.
  • Master plan - A pension plan that is made available by a sponsor for adoption by employers; that is the subject of a favorable opinion letter; and for which a single funding medium (for example, a trust or custodial account) is established for the joint use of all adopting employers.
